Der richtige Ort zum Verweisen auf ein externes Stylesheet in einem HTML-Dokument ist: der Teil „“. Da der Browsercode von oben nach unten analysiert wird, wird bei langsamer Netzwerkgeschwindigkeit der HTML-Code geladen, das CSS jedoch nicht, was dazu führt, dass die Seite keinen Stil hat schwer zu lesen, daher kann das Laden des CSS-Stils zuerst erfolgen Lassen Sie die Seite normal anzeigen.
Die Betriebsumgebung dieses Tutorials: Windows7-System, CSS3- und HTML5-Version, Dell G3-Computer.
Der richtige Ort zum Verweisen auf ein externes Stylesheet in einem HTML-Dokument ist: der Abschnitt „<head>“.
Warum muss der Header-<head>
-Teil im externen Link-CSS platziert werden?
Zunächst wird dem Benutzer die gesamte Seite angezeigt und durchläuft den HTML-Parsing- und Rendering-Prozess.
Das CSS des externen Links hat keinen Einfluss auf die Analyse von HTML, aber es wirkt sich auf die Darstellung von HTML aus, unabhängig davon, wo es platziert ist.
Wenn Sie das CSS am Ende einfügen, kann der Inhalt des HTML sofort angezeigt werden, es blockiert jedoch die Darstellung des CSS in der HTML-Zeile. [Empfohlenes Tutorial: CSS-Video-Tutorial]
Diese Strategie des Browsers ist tatsächlich sehr klug. Stellen Sie sich vor, dass die Seite ohne diese Strategie zunächst einen Inline-CSS-Stil anzeigt und dann plötzlich zu einem anderen wechselt, nachdem das CSS heruntergeladen wurde. Aussehen. Die Benutzererfahrung ist äußerst schlecht und das Rendern ist kostspielig.
Wenn Sie CSS an den Kopf stellen, kann das Herunterladen und Parsen von CSS gleichzeitig mit dem Parsen von HTML erfolgen. Wenn Sie es ans Ende setzen, dauert das Parsen des CSS länger und der Browser rendert zuerst eine nicht gestylte Seite usw. Nachdem das CSS geladen wurde, wird es in eine gestylte Seite gerendert und die Seite blinkt offensichtlich.
Weitere Kenntnisse zum Thema Computerprogrammierung finden Sie unter: Programmiervideos! !
Das obige ist der detaillierte Inhalt vonWo ist der richtige Ort, um auf ein externes Stylesheet in einem HTML-Dokument zu verweisen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!